Fleet Composition and Numbers: A Quantitative Look
When we talk about India Pakistan fighter jets, the sheer numbers often come up first. According to FlightGlobal’s World Air Forces directory for 2025, India commands a significantly larger fleet with 616 combat aircraft, while Pakistan has a fleet of 387 jets. India’s overall military aircraft count is also higher, with 2,229 military aircraft compared to Pakistan’s 1,399, as per a May 2025 report. However, as any defense analyst will tell you, it’s not just about who has more planes; the type and quality of these aircraft, along with pilot training and strategic deployment, are equally crucial.
The Indian Air Force (IAF) operates a diverse mix of aircraft from various international suppliers, including Russia, France, and the UK, alongside indigenously developed platforms. The Pakistan Air Force (PAF), on the other hand, has historically relied heavily on the United States and China for its aircraft. This difference in sourcing impacts everything from maintenance and upgrades to interoperability and strategic alignment. Key Players: Rafale vs. JF-17 Thunder
At the cutting edge of the India Pakistan fighter jets comparison are the French-made Dassault Rafale for India and the Sino-Pakistani jointly developed JF-17 Thunder for Pakistan. India considers the Rafale its “highest profile asset,” having inducted 36 of these 4.5-generation multirole fighters. The Rafale is known for its advanced avionics, including the Thales RBE2 AESA radar, integrated sensor fusion, and the sophisticated SPECTRA electronic warfare suite. It carries a range of potent weapons, including Meteor beyond-visual-range air-to-air missiles and SCALP cruise missiles.
Pakistan’s JF-17 Thunder, particularly the Block III variant, is a 4th-generation lightweight, single-engine multirole fighter. While generally considered less advanced than the Rafale, the JF-17 Block III is equipped with a KLJ-7A AESA radar and can carry modern BVR missiles like the PL-15. Pakistan has a significant number of JF-17s, with reports suggesting a fleet of 156 jets as of late 2024. The JF-17 offers a cost-effective solution and is a symbol of the relationship between Islamabad and Beijing. When comparing the JF-17 Thunder and Dassault Rafale, the Rafale generally stands out as the superior platform in terms of technological sophistication and overall combat capabilities, though the JF-17 offers advantages in affordability and ease of maintenance for certain air forces.
It’s interesting to note the difference in design philosophies. The Rafale is a twin-engine, heavier aircraft designed for high-end combat missions across all combat domains, while the JF-17 is a lighter, single-engine fighter. This impacts factors like payload capacity, range, and maneuverability. The Rafale has a higher maximum takeoff weight and more external hardpoints for carrying weapons compared to the JF-17.

The F-16 and Tejas Comparison
Beyond the Rafale and JF-17, both air forces operate other significant fighter types. Pakistan has a considerable fleet of US-made F-16 Fighting Falcons. The F-16 is a widely proven multirole fighter known for its air dominance capabilities, especially in dogfighting scenarios. Pakistan’s F-16s have been subject to “end-user agreements” with the US, which can limit their operational deployment.
India’s indigenous Light Combat Aircraft (LCA) Tejas is another key component of the IAF’s modernization efforts. The Tejas, a lightweight multirole fighter, is gradually being inducted into the IAF fleet. While the Tejas Mk1 has been compared to earlier blocks of the JF-17, with some analyses suggesting the Tejas has better survivability due to a lower radar cross-section (RCS), the F-16 generally outperforms the Tejas in terms of engine thrust, speed, and operational range. The F-16’s larger size and weight allow for higher payloads and extended missions compared to the lighter Tejas.
Modernization Efforts and Future Plans
Both India and Pakistan are actively pursuing modernization programs to enhance their air force capabilities. India aims to increase its squadron strength and is looking to acquire 114 new medium multirole fighter jets through the MRFA program, with contenders including the Rafale, Eurofighter Typhoon, F-15EX, and F-21. India is also developing its own fifth-generation stealth fighter, the Advanced Medium Combat Aircraft (AMCA).
Pakistan, too, has initiated a significant modernization drive, particularly following the February 2019 skirmish with India. The PAF is phasing out older aircraft like the F-7Ps and Mirage IIIs and replacing them with more modern platforms like the Chinese J-10CE and JF-17C. Pakistan has also unveiled the PFX (Pakistan Fighter Experimental) program, an upgrade to the JF-17 with stealth features, and is in the process of acquiring Chinese J-35 fifth-generation fighter jets.
Electronic Warfare and Air Defense Systems
Modern aerial combat isn’t just about fighter jets; electronic warfare (EW) and air defense systems play a crucial role. The Rafale’s SPECTRA EW suite is considered among the most advanced globally. Pakistan has also been investing in EW/ESM systems as part of its modernization.
In terms of air defense, India has a multi-layered system, including the S-400. Pakistan operates systems like the Chinese HQ-9 and HQ-16. The Balakot Incident: A Case Study
The aerial engagements in February 2019 following the Pulwama attack offer a real-world glimpse into how India Pakistan fighter jets might perform in a conflict scenario. India used Mirage 2000 fighter jets armed with Spice 2000 precision-guided bombs for the Balakot airstrike. Pakistan responded with Operation Swift Retort, involving their F-16s, JF-17s, and Mirage III/Vs. The incident saw claims and counter-claims regarding aircraft shot down. Beyond the Hardware: Training and Strategy
Beyond the technical specifications of India Pakistan fighter jets lies the equally important aspect of pilot training and strategic doctrine. Both air forces regularly conduct exercises to hone their skills. Some analyses suggest that Pakistan, despite a smaller fleet, benefits from coherent planning, interoperable technologies, and a responsive command structure. India, with its diverse inventory, faces the challenge of integrating varied systems.
The strategic objectives also differ. India is focused on countering threats from both Pakistan and China, which influences its procurement of a range of aircraft for different roles. Pakistan’s strategy is primarily centered on deterrence against India. These strategic considerations shape how each air force structures its training and deploys its assets.
